Day 1: Foundations of Feasibility Analysis
Introduction to the investment lifecycle; components of a feasibility study; the strategic alignment of projects.
Day 2: Market and Technical Feasibility
Conducting market research and analysis; assessing technical requirements, resources, and operational logistics.
Day 3: Financial Modeling and Forecasting
Building integrated financial models; projecting revenues, costs, and capital expenditures.
Day 4: Investment Appraisal and Risk Analysis
Applying NPV, IRR, and other appraisal metrics; conducting sensitivity and scenario analysis.
Day 5: Synthesis and Decision-Making
Compiling the feasibility study report; presenting findings; the investment decision-making process.
